General Atlantic, a global growth equity firm, has appointed Lord Browne of Madingley as a Senior Advisor, based in London. Lord Browne will advise the firm on environmental, social and governance considerations, with a particular focus on the path to Net Zero emissions. He will work with General Atlantic to find new ways to invest in climate solutions, and help develop corporate strategies for addressing global climate change. Westmount Park Investments (Westmount Park) has appointed Michael Pangia, as President and COO.  In this newly created role, Pangia will lead all operational aspects of the organisation and its growing number of affiliates, subsidiaries, and portfolio companies. Pangia will also oversee the company’s financing initiatives including management of relationships with investment banks and other capital advisors. He has over 25 years of senior management experience, with a demonstrated track record of successful outcomes of growing and restructuring businesses. VEGAMOUR, a direct-to-consumer, clean hair wellness brand, today announced USD80 million in funding from General Atlantic, a leading global growth equity firm. The Company will use the new funds to further its organic e-commerce growth, launch additional products and expand into new channels and geographies.  Founded in 2016 by CEO Daniel Hodgdon, VEGAMOUR is a plant-based hair wellness brand that incorporates a comprehensive range of naturally-derived products to support healthy hair growth and wellness. Skin & Tonic, a skincare and wellbeing brand founded in Hackney, London, has secured GBP830,000 in funding, enabling it to fulfil increased production demands and expand its operations to Manchester. Driven by GC Angels, this includes a GBP605,000 investment from the angel investment service alongside private investors, as well as a GBP225,000 loan from NPIF – FW Capital, managed by FW Capital and part of the Northern Powerhouse Investment Fund (NPIF). Founded in 2015, Skin & Tonic’s innovative, results-led products are formulated using certified organic, sustainably sourced ingredients and presented in recyclable or zero waste packaging. Rainier Partners has acquired Calpine Containers, Inc, and its subsidiaries (Calpine) in partnership with members of the company’s management team. Headquartered in Clovis, CA, Calpine is one of the largest West Coast packaging distributors serving the agriculture industry. Partners Group, a leading global private markets firm, has, on behalf of its clients, sold a large-scale portfolio of US industrial properties (the Portfolio) at a Gross Asset Value of over USD1 billion.  
Primus Capital, a growth-oriented private equity firm, has made a minority investment in LiquidityBook, a Software-as-a-Service (SaaS)-based provider of buy- and sell-side trading solutions.  The capital will enable LiquidityBook to further scale its business and serve a broader array of fund managers and financial institutions through its industry-leading portfolio, order and execution management system (POEMS) platform. LiquidityBook will use the funds to enhance its products in response to client demand for additional functionality that goes beyond the traditional POEMS.
